LAYTON, Utah, Sept. 10, 2019 (Gephardt Daily) — More than 3,700 Rocky Mountain Power customers were without electricity late Tuesday afternoon.
RMP tweeted that it was working to restore damaged lines.

The outage, caused by damaged line, was first reported at 4:24 p.m., the company’s website said. Customers affected live in the 84040, 84037 and 84025 zip code areas.
“Customers” refers to account holders, so the number of individuals without power would be far greater.”
